The Raiders have traded for cornerback Taron Johnson from the Bills before he became a free agent. In exchange, the Bills receive a sixth-round draft pick while giving up a seventh-round selection. Johnson, a fourth-round pick in 2018, has played 113 regular-season games with 87 starts and was a second-team All-Pro in 2023. He is under contract through 2027, with a base salary of $8.1 million in 2026.
